The Good Samaritan
好撒玛利亚人
有一个律法师,起来试探耶稣说,夫子,我该作什么才可以承受永生。耶稣对他说,律法上写的是什么?你念的是怎样呢?他回答说,你要尽心,尽性,尽力,尽意,爱主你的神。又要爱邻舍如同自己。耶稣说,你回答的是。你这样行,就必得永生。
那人要显明自己有理,就对耶稣说,谁是我的邻舍呢?
耶稣回答说,有一个人从耶路撒冷下耶利哥去,落在强盗手中,他们剥去他的衣裳,把他打个半死,就丢下他走了。偶然有一个祭司,从这条路下来。看见他就从那边过去了。又有一个利未人,来到这地方,看见他,也照样从那边过去了。惟有一个撒玛利亚人,行路来到那里。看见他就动了慈心,上前用油和酒倒在他的伤处,包裹好了,扶他骑上自己的牲口,带到店里去照应他。第二天拿出二钱银子来,交给店主说,你且照应他。此外所费用的,我回来必还你。
你想这三个人,那一个是落在强盗手中的邻舍呢?他说,是怜悯他的。耶稣说,你去照样行吧。
(路加福音 10:25~37 和合本)

And a lawyer stood up and put Him to the test, saying, “Teacher, what shall I do to inherit eternal life?” And He said to him, “What is written in the Law? How does it read to you?” And he answered, “You shall love the Lord your God with all your heart, and with all your soul, and with all your strength, and with all your mind; and your neighbor as yourself.” And He said to him, “You have answered correctly; do this and you will live.”
But wishing to justify himself, he said to Jesus, “And who is my neighbor?”
Jesus replied and said, “A man was going down from Jerusalem to Jericho, and fell among robbers, and they stripped him and beat him, and went away leaving him half dead. And by chance a priest was going down on that road, and when he saw him, he passed by on the other side. Likewise a Levite also, when he came to the place and saw him, passed by on the other side. But a Samaritan, who was on a journey, came upon him; and when he saw him, he felt compassion, and came to him and bandaged up his wounds, pouring oil and wine on them; and he put him on his own beast, and brought him to an inn and took care of him. On the next day he took out two denarii and gave them to the innkeeper and said, ‘Take care of him; and whatever more you spend, when I return I will repay you.’ Which of these three do you think proved to be a neighbor to the man who fell into the robbers’ hands?” And he said, “The one who showed mercy toward him.” Then Jesus said to him, “Go and do the same.”
(Luke 10: 25~37, NASB)
